Analysis
In 2023, net official development assistance received (current us$), per in Grenada stood at 113,219 current US$ per square kilometre.
Compared with earlier readings it is up 141.1% on the previous year and up 207.3% over ten years.
Over the whole period, net official development assistance received (current us$), per in Grenada peaked at 204,699 current US$ per square kilometre in 2020 and was at its lowest, -275,407 current US$ per square kilometre, in 2022.
Grenada ranks 11th of 169 countries on this measure, in the top 10%.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

How this figure is calculated
Net official development assistance received (current US$) divided by Land area (sq. km), mat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
Net official development assistance received (current US$) ÷ Land area (sq. km)
Computed from
- Net official development assistance received Development Assistance Committee, Organisation for Economic Co-operation and Development (OECD)
- Land area FAOSTAT,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ations (FAO)
Statizoid computes this series; the underlying measurements belong to the publishers named above. The arithmetic is applied to every country and year where both inputs report, and nothing is estimated unless the page says so.
